| /f-stack/freebsd/contrib/openzfs/cmd/zed/agents/ |
| H A D | zfs_retire.c | 168 if (vdev_guid != 0) { in find_by_guid() 270 uint64_t pool_guid, vdev_guid; in zfs_vdev_repair() local 289 zrp->zrr_vdev == vdev_guid) in zfs_vdev_repair() 296 zrp->zrr_vdev = vdev_guid; in zfs_vdev_repair() 300 vdev_guid, pool_guid); in zfs_vdev_repair() 308 uint64_t pool_guid, vdev_guid; in zfs_retire_recv() local 344 &vdev_guid) != 0) in zfs_retire_recv() 453 &vdev_guid) != 0) { in zfs_retire_recv() 455 vdev_guid = 0; in zfs_retire_recv() 467 if (vdev_guid == 0) { in zfs_retire_recv() [all …]
|
| H A D | zfs_diagnosis.c | 171 uint64_t vdev_guid = 0; in zfs_mark_vdev() local 184 zcp->zc_data.zc_vdev_guid == vdev_guid) { in zfs_mark_vdev() 452 uint64_t ena, pool_guid, vdev_guid; in zfs_fm_recv() local 480 &vdev_guid) != 0) in zfs_fm_recv() 539 vdev_guid = 0; in zfs_fm_recv() 551 if (zcp->zc_data.zc_vdev_guid == vdev_guid) in zfs_fm_recv() 616 class, vdev_guid); in zfs_fm_recv() 639 vdev_guid, class); in zfs_fm_recv() 651 data.zc_vdev_guid = vdev_guid; in zfs_fm_recv() 788 pool_guid, vdev_guid, "io"); in zfs_fm_recv() [all …]
|
| H A D | zfs_agents.c | 194 uint64_t pool_guid = 0, vdev_guid = 0; in zfs_agent_post_event() local 203 (void) nvlist_lookup_uint64(nvl, ZFS_EV_VDEV_GUID, &vdev_guid); in zfs_agent_post_event() 218 vdev_guid = search.gs_vdev_guid; in zfs_agent_post_event() 238 FM_EREPORT_PAYLOAD_ZFS_VDEV_GUID, vdev_guid); in zfs_agent_post_event()
|
| /f-stack/freebsd/contrib/openzfs/module/os/freebsd/zfs/ |
| H A D | zfs_ioctl_os.c | 104 uint64_t vdev_guid; in zfs_ioc_nextboot() local 111 ZPOOL_CONFIG_GUID, &vdev_guid) != 0) in zfs_ioc_nextboot() 118 spa = spa_by_guid(pool_guid, vdev_guid); in zfs_ioc_nextboot() 128 vd = spa_lookup_by_guid(spa, vdev_guid, B_TRUE); in zfs_ioc_nextboot()
|
| H A D | vdev_geom.c | 168 vdev_online(spa, vd->vdev_guid, ZFS_ONLINE_EXPAND, NULL); in vdev_geom_resize() 540 uint64_t vdev_guid; in process_vdev_config() local 648 uint64_t pool_guid, top_guid, vdev_guid; in vdev_attach_ok() local 671 vdev_guid = 0; in vdev_attach_ok() 672 (void) nvlist_lookup_uint64(config, ZPOOL_CONFIG_GUID, &vdev_guid); in vdev_attach_ok() 691 if (vdev_guid == vd->vdev_guid) { in vdev_attach_ok() 694 } else if (top_guid == vd->vdev_guid && vd == vd->vdev_top) { in vdev_attach_ok() 699 pp->name, (uintmax_t)vd->vdev_guid, (uintmax_t)vdev_guid); in vdev_attach_ok() 762 (uintmax_t)spa_guid(vd->vdev_spa), (uintmax_t)vd->vdev_guid); in vdev_geom_open_by_guids() 774 (uintmax_t)vd->vdev_guid, cp->provider->name); in vdev_geom_open_by_guids() [all …]
|
| /f-stack/freebsd/contrib/openzfs/include/os/linux/zfs/sys/ |
| H A D | trace_arc.h | 130 __field(uint64_t, vdev_guid) 136 __entry->vdev_guid = vd->vdev_guid; 141 ZIO_TP_PRINTK_FMT, __entry->vdev_id, __entry->vdev_guid, 312 __field(uint64_t, vdev_guid) 326 __entry->vdev_guid = dev->l2ad_vdev->vdev_guid; 341 __entry->vdev_id, __entry->vdev_guid, __entry->vdev_state,
|
| /f-stack/freebsd/contrib/openzfs/lib/libzfs/ |
| H A D | libzfs_import.c | 306 uint64_t guid, vdev_guid; in zpool_in_use() local 326 &vdev_guid) == 0); in zpool_in_use() 385 ret = find_guid(nvroot, vdev_guid); in zpool_in_use() 424 cb.cb_guid = vdev_guid; in zpool_in_use() 440 cb.cb_guid = vdev_guid; in zpool_in_use()
|
| /f-stack/freebsd/contrib/openzfs/lib/libzutil/ |
| H A D | zutil_import.c | 279 uint64_t pool_guid, vdev_guid, top_guid, txg, state; in add_config() local 293 nvlist_lookup_uint64(config, ZPOOL_CONFIG_GUID, &vdev_guid) == 0) { in add_config() 301 ne->ne_guid = vdev_guid; in add_config() 321 &vdev_guid) != 0 || in add_config() 399 ne->ne_guid = vdev_guid; in add_config() 984 uint64_t vdev_guid, char **path, char **devid) in label_paths_impl() argument 996 pool_guid, vdev_guid, path, devid); in label_paths_impl() 1007 if ((error != 0) || (guid != vdev_guid)) in label_paths_impl() 1031 uint64_t vdev_guid; in label_paths() local 1038 nvlist_lookup_uint64(label, ZPOOL_CONFIG_GUID, &vdev_guid)) in label_paths() [all …]
|
| /f-stack/freebsd/contrib/openzfs/lib/libzutil/os/linux/ |
| H A D | zutil_import_os.c | 109 uint64_t vdev_guid = 0; in zpool_open_func() local 173 error = nvlist_lookup_uint64(config, ZPOOL_CONFIG_GUID, &vdev_guid); in zpool_open_func() 174 if (error || (rn->rn_vdev_guid && rn->rn_vdev_guid != vdev_guid)) { in zpool_open_func() 214 slice->rn_vdev_guid = vdev_guid; in zpool_open_func() 240 slice->rn_vdev_guid = vdev_guid; in zpool_open_func()
|
| /f-stack/freebsd/contrib/openzfs/module/zfs/ |
| H A D | spa_stats.c | 623 uint64_t vdev_guid; /* unique ID of leaf vdev */ member 654 (u_longlong_t)smh->vdev_guid, (u_longlong_t)smh->vdev_label, in spa_mmp_history_show() 739 smh->vdev_guid++; in spa_mmp_history_set_skip() 801 smh->vdev_guid = vd->vdev_guid; in spa_mmp_history_add() 811 smh->vdev_guid = 1; in spa_mmp_history_add()
|
| H A D | vdev.c | 136 (u_longlong_t)vd->vdev_guid, buf); in vdev_dbgmsg() 184 (u_longlong_t)vd->vdev_guid, in vdev_dbgmsg_print_tree() 377 if (vd->vdev_guid == guid) in vdev_lookup_by_guid() 572 vd->vdev_guid = guid; in vdev_alloc_common() 1259 uint64_t guid_delta = mvd->vdev_guid - cvd->vdev_guid; in vdev_remove_parent() 1261 cvd->vdev_guid += guid_delta; in vdev_remove_parent() 2173 if (vd->vdev_guid != guid && vd->vdev_guid != aux_guid) { in vdev_validate() 2179 if (vd->vdev_guid != top_guid && in vdev_validate() 2191 (u_longlong_t)vd->vdev_guid, in vdev_validate() 2272 if (svd->vdev_guid != dvd->vdev_guid) { in vdev_copy_path_strict() [all …]
|
| H A D | vdev_label.c | 438 fnvlist_add_uint64(nv, ZPOOL_CONFIG_GUID, vd->vdev_guid); in vdev_config_generate() 1015 uint64_t guid_delta = spare_guid - vd->vdev_guid; in vdev_label_init() 1017 vd->vdev_guid += guid_delta; in vdev_label_init() 1035 uint64_t guid_delta = l2cache_guid - vd->vdev_guid; in vdev_label_init() 1037 vd->vdev_guid += guid_delta; in vdev_label_init() 1081 vd->vdev_guid) == 0); in vdev_label_init() 1094 vd->vdev_guid) == 0); in vdev_label_init() 1181 spa_spare_exists(vd->vdev_guid, NULL, NULL))) in vdev_label_init() 1186 spa_l2cache_exists(vd->vdev_guid, NULL))) in vdev_label_init()
|
| H A D | zfs_fm.c | 281 search.re_vdev_guid = vd->vdev_guid; in zfs_ereport_is_duplicate() 438 vd != NULL ? vd->vdev_guid : 0); in zfs_ereport_start() 476 DATA_TYPE_UINT64, vd->vdev_guid, in zfs_ereport_start() 525 DATA_TYPE_UINT64, pvd->vdev_guid, in zfs_ereport_start() 549 spare_guids[i] = spare_vd->vdev_guid; in zfs_ereport_start() 1257 FM_EREPORT_PAYLOAD_ZFS_VDEV_GUID, vd->vdev_guid)); in zfs_event_create()
|
| H A D | zio_inject.c | 334 if (zio->io_vd->vdev_guid == handler->zi_record.zi_guid && in zio_handle_label_injection() 386 if (vd->vdev_guid == handler->zi_record.zi_guid) { in zio_handle_device_injection_impl() 605 if (vd->vdev_guid != handler->zi_record.zi_guid) in zio_handle_io_delay()
|
| H A D | spa_config.c | 458 vd->vdev_top->vdev_guid); in spa_config_generate() 460 vd->vdev_guid); in spa_config_generate()
|
| H A D | vdev_rebuild.c | 253 (u_longlong_t)vd->vdev_id, (u_longlong_t)vd->vdev_guid); in vdev_rebuild_initiate_sync() 322 (u_longlong_t)vd->vdev_id, (u_longlong_t)vd->vdev_guid); in vdev_rebuild_complete_sync() 367 (u_longlong_t)vd->vdev_id, (u_longlong_t)vd->vdev_guid); in vdev_rebuild_cancel_sync() 415 (u_longlong_t)vd->vdev_id, (u_longlong_t)vd->vdev_guid); in vdev_rebuild_reset_sync()
|
| H A D | spa.c | 863 rvd->vdev_guid = *newguid; in spa_change_guid_sync() 5503 vd->vdev_guid) == 0); 6925 if (pvd->vdev_guid != pguid && pguid != 0) 7028 unspare_guid = cvd->vdev_guid; 7814 guid = vd->vdev_guid; 7815 pguid = pvd->vdev_guid; 7816 ppguid = ppvd->vdev_guid; 7826 sguid = ppvd->vdev_child[1]->vdev_guid; 9325 if (vd->vdev_guid == guid) 9331 if (vd->vdev_guid == guid) [all …]
|
| H A D | spa_misc.c | 956 search.aux_guid = vd->vdev_guid; in spa_aux_add() 961 aux->aux_guid = vd->vdev_guid; in spa_aux_add() 974 search.aux_guid = vd->vdev_guid; in spa_aux_remove() 1018 search.aux_guid = vd->vdev_guid; in spa_aux_activate() 1694 spa->spa_last_synced_guid : spa->spa_root_vdev->vdev_guid; in spa_guid() 1701 return (spa->spa_root_vdev->vdev_guid); in spa_guid()
|
| H A D | vdev_initialize.c | 116 *guid = vd->vdev_guid; in vdev_initialize_change_state() 219 *guid = vd->vdev_guid; in vdev_initialize_write()
|
| H A D | fm.c | 1450 uint64_t vdev_guid) in fm_fmri_zfs_set() argument 1471 if (vdev_guid != 0) { in fm_fmri_zfs_set() 1472 if (nvlist_add_uint64(fmri, FM_FMRI_ZFS_VDEV, vdev_guid) != 0) { in fm_fmri_zfs_set()
|
| H A D | mmp.c | 489 spa_name(spa), gethrtime(), vd->vdev_guid); in mmp_write_uberblock()
|
| H A D | vdev_draid.c | 1928 cvd->vdev_guid); in vdev_draid_spare_create() 2681 uint64_t guid = vd->vdev_guid; in vdev_draid_read_config_spare() 2690 fnvlist_add_uint64(nv, ZPOOL_CONFIG_TOP_GUID, vd->vdev_top->vdev_guid); in vdev_draid_read_config_spare() 2699 guid = sav->sav_vdevs[i]->vdev_guid; in vdev_draid_read_config_spare()
|
| H A D | vdev_trim.c | 282 *guid = vd->vdev_guid; in vdev_trim_change_state() 514 *guid = vd->vdev_guid; in vdev_trim_range()
|
| /f-stack/freebsd/contrib/openzfs/include/sys/ |
| H A D | vdev_impl.h | 232 uint64_t vdev_guid; /* unique ID for this vdev */ member
|
| /f-stack/freebsd/contrib/openzfs/cmd/ztest/ |
| H A D | ztest.c | 3110 guid = mg->mg_vd->vdev_guid; in ztest_vdev_add_remove() 3286 guid = svd->vdev_guid; in ztest_vdev_aux_add_remove() 3547 oldguid = oldvd->vdev_guid; in ztest_vdev_attach_detach() 3552 pguid = pvd->vdev_guid; in ztest_vdev_attach_detach() 3718 guid = vd->vdev_guid; in ztest_device_removal() 3796 uint64_t guid = vd->vdev_guid; in online_vdev() 5991 guid0 = vd0->vdev_guid; in ztest_fault_inject() 6005 guid0 = vd0->vdev_guid; in ztest_fault_inject() 6468 uint64_t guid = rand_vd->vdev_guid; in ztest_initialize() 6540 uint64_t guid = rand_vd->vdev_guid; in ztest_trim()
|